Course Description: Introduction to common health
hazards that are encountered in the workplace, including exposure to
chemicals, asbestos, silica and lead, identification of hazards, sources
of exposure, health hazard information, evaluation of exposure and
engineering and work practice controls. The course is an awareness
course for employers and employees.
Prerequisites: None
